Oher works his way back

SPARTANBURG, S.C. – The day after the Panthers' offseason workout program came to an official close, left tackle Michael Oher signed a three-year contract extension that will keep him with the Panthers through the 2019 season.

Once Oher put pen to paper, he had more than a month of free time before training camp and a lot more financial security at his disposal.

So how did he celebrate the momentous occasion?

"I didn't do anything major; I forgot what I did," Oher said. "I was excited, though. It gives me an opportunity to be here a little bit longer.
